The 1965 Ford Mustang coupe was the official 2nd year of production for the Mustang. This head turning 1965 Ford Mustang coupe RESTOMOD is now up for sale. They say “a picture is worth a thousand words” and while you take in these photographs of the Mustang Coupe I hope you'll also agree. This Mustang has the Shelby Hood. Lemans Silver Striping. Sonic Blue which emulates the Shelby GT look.  Modifications were added to enhance its performance. safety. comfort. and appeal. As a result of many man hours and resources  she has covered approximately 2 thousand road tested miles. She finally crossed the finish line for me. The photographs shown here reveal an eye-popping bright paint job. The clear coats gives the mirror like finish it deserves. New halogen  55/65 headlights with the “FOMOCO “script installed. Bright led bulbs light up on the tail end. Back-up lights and switch are newly installed. The shiny trim pieces on the front Shelby hood. windshield. rear window. side vents and roll up windows gleaming. The interior of the vehicle has also been restored. New Pony buckets and rear bench seats are pictured with the running Pony and new seat belts. The headliner is new along with new black floor carpeting  including the trunk floor. She runs on polished Torq-Thrust II wheels by American Racing and wrapping around them are new Sumitomo radials. front 225/45ZR17 90W- rear 245/45ZR17.   Interior-wise. new cigarette lighter and housing installed. turn signal lever and cam. brighter blue Led bulbs installed in the instrument panel. red high beam indicator. red alt and oil indicators. green turn signal indicator. New windshield wipers. New sun visors also. NOS was installed for safety as well. Brake lever mechanism was newly installed. “Sun” low profile 8k tachometer functional. courtesy lighting activated by the door switches on the driver and passenger sides. Passenger's courtesy light also can be activated by a turn of the headlight switch. Also featured is a 500W 4/3/2 channel amp Ken wood CD AM FM Stereo sound system Model KAC6404 MAX POWER plus 2/1 channel 800W stereo power amplifier model XM-1252GTR installed. This stereo system is operable with the remote control unit. Two powerful speakers in front and two in the rear. The electronic unit is installed in the glove compartment.   KYG gas shocks. 1 ¼” front and 1” rear stabilizer bars which stabilize and mitigate “roll” truly enhance your ride. New chrome oil pan. new oil filter/oil change with 10-30w. New wheel bearings. new master cylinder. new brake lines including power brakes. manual steering is good. new slotted front disk brake and new brake pads for the rear drums. It is totally dry underneath the vehicle very important.                                                                                                                                                                        The Engine bay is rust free and dry. matching VIN numbers located on each side of top fender arms. rebuilt 289 CID 225 hp engine married with the rebuilt 3 speed top loader 4C synchromesh transmission. manual steering and 8” rear. new Edelbrock 4 bbl 600 cfm carburetor. electronic ignition multiple signal distribution unit. “Hooker” Headers and dual steel exhaust system enhances exhaust and horsepower. Acceleration is phenomenal! Chrome plated air cleaner with wing nut. gleaming chrome reinforcement brace and the Monte Carlo Bar prevents body flex. New battery. new voltage regulator. blue 8mm MSD Heli-core solid suppression ultra-temp spark plug wires. engine tuneup completed. new chrome alternator. fan belt. new “Champion” aluminum high efficiency radiator and hoses. new wide fan shroud together eliminates overheating in hot weather. heater defroster fan functional as well.                                                                                                                                                                                                As you can see quite a bit of work has been done.
